Syntax-directed editors can perform syntax analysis during program editing. This capability allows programmers to correct syntax errors in a much more efficient way. Because of this, syntax-directed editors have become an integral component in current integrated development environments. This paper describes a tool that is designed to facilitate the construction of syntax-directed editors. This tool consists of two components: a generator for incremental parsers and a simple application program interface that facilitates the integration of incremental parsers and editors. The application program interface is based on a simple editing model that can be applied in most editors.
